OLD PUPILS' REUNION

HAMILTON HIGH SCHOOL A SUCCESSFUL GATHERING [from our own correspondent] HAMILTON, Sunday Old pupils of the Hamilton High School from all part 3 of the district and a number from Auckland and Wellington, gathered in Hamilton yesterday for the annual reunion. The attendance was tho largest there has been at tho reunion. Tho annual dinner was held last evening, Mr. C. A. Speight presiding over a largo attendance. The ceremonies concluded with a danco held by tho Old Girls' and Old Boys' Associations in tho school assembly hall. In reviewing the past year's operations at the 21st annual meeting of tho Old Boys' Association, tho'president, Mr. C. A. Speight, said the activities during tho period had proved very successful, and members could bo proud of tho strong position the association had attained. Strong branches had been formed in Auckland and Wellington. Members had always taken a keen interest in the welfare of the school, and it was interesting to note in this connection that since 1920 tho old boys had raised about £SOO for various purposesi.
